Blue Gold's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 was $3.47 Mil. Blue Gold's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 was $0.00 Mil. Blue Gold's Total Stockholders Equity for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 was $-20.16 Mil. Blue Gold's debt to equity for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 was -0.17.

A high debt to equity ratio generally means that a company has been aggressive in financing its growth with debt. This can result in volatile earnings as a result of the additional interest expense.

Blue Gold  (NAS:BGL) Debt-to-Equity Explanation

In the calculation of Debt to Equity, we use the total of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ation and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ation divided by Total Stockholders Equity. In some calculations, Total Liabilities is used to for calculation.


Be Aware

Because a company can increase its ROE % by having more financial leverage, it is important to watch the leverage ratio when investing in high ROE % companies.

Blue Gold Ltd is a gold mining company engaged in the business of developing, financing, licensing, and operating gold mines in Ghana and elsewhere. Its flagship project is the Bogoso Prestea Mine in Ghana's Ashanti Gold Belt.
